@font-face{font-family:"LL Circular Pro";src:url("https://f.hubspotusercontent20.net/hubfs/2950575/fonts/lineto-circular-pro-black.eot");src:url("https://f.hubspotusercontent20.net/hubfs/2950575/fonts/lineto-circular-pro-black.eot?#iefix") format("embedded-opentype"),url("https://f.hubspotusercontent20.net/hubfs/2950575/fonts/lineto-circular-pro-black.woff2") format("woff2"),url("https://f.hubspotusercontent20.net/hubfs/2950575/fonts/lineto-circular-pro-black.woff") format("woff");font-weight:900;font-style:normal}@font-face{font-family:"LL Circular Pro";src:url("https://f.hubspotusercontent20.net/hubfs/2950575/fonts/lineto-circular-pro-bold.eot");src:url("https://f.hubspotusercontent20.net/hubfs/2950575/fonts/lineto-circular-pro-bold.eot?#iefix") format("embedded-opentype"),url("https://f.hubspotusercontent20.net/hubfs/2950575/fonts/lineto-circular-pro-bold.woff2") format("woff2"),url("https://f.hubspotusercontent20.net/hubfs/2950575/fonts/lineto-circular-pro-bold.woff") format("woff");font-weight:700;font-style:normal}@font-face{font-family:"LL Circular Pro";src:url("https://f.hubspotusercontent20.net/hubfs/2950575/fonts/lineto-circular-pro-book.eot");src:url("https://f.hubspotusercontent20.net/hubfs/2950575/fonts/lineto-circular-pro-book.eot?#iefix") format("embedded-opentype"),url("https://f.hubspotusercontent20.net/hubfs/2950575/fonts/lineto-circular-pro-book.woff2") format("woff2"),url("https://f.hubspotusercontent20.net/hubfs/2950575/fonts/lineto-circular-pro-book.woff") format("woff");font-weight:400;font-style:normal}@font-face{font-family:"LL Circular Pro";src:url("https://f.hubspotusercontent20.net/hubfs/2950575/fonts/lineto-circular-pro-medium.eot");src:url("https://f.hubspotusercontent20.net/hubfs/2950575/fonts/lineto-circular-pro-medium.eot?#iefix") format("embedded-opentype"),url("https://f.hubspotusercontent20.net/hubfs/2950575/fonts/lineto-circular-pro-medium.woff2") format("woff2"),url("https://f.hubspotusercontent20.net/hubfs/2950575/fonts/lineto-circular-pro-medium.woff") format("woff");font-weight:500;font-style:normal}*,*::before,*::after{margin:0;padding:0;-webkit-box-sizing:border-box;box-sizing:border-box}html{font-size:62.5%}body{font-family:"LL Circular Pro",sans-serif;color:#10275b;font-size:1.6rem;font-weight:400;line-height:1.3;background-color:#f8f8f8}.container{width:100%;max-width:1440px;margin:0 auto;padding:0 20px}ul{list-style:none}h2{font-size:3.1rem;line-height:3.2rem}p,.content-wrap,.content-wrap p{font-size:2rem;padding:15px 0}.hero__img .cta-wrap .cta_button{width:auto !important;min-width:0;max-width:unset;padding:15px 30px !important}.cta-wrap .cta_button{display:inline-block !important;width:auto !important;max-width:239px !important;border-radius:97px !important;background:#fa5767 !important;color:#fff !important;font-size:14px !important;line-height:19px !important;font-weight:700 !important;font-family:'LL Circular Pro' !important;text-align:center !important;padding:11px 30px !important;text-decoration:none !important;text-transform:uppercase !important;transition:background-color .3s ease-in-out !important}.cta-wrap .cta_button strong{color:#fff !important;font-size:14px !important;line-height:19px !important;font-weight:700 !important;font-family:inherit !important}.cta-wrap .cta_button:hover{border:none !important;background:#eb4453 !important;box-shadow:none !important}.cta-wrap .cta_button p{padding:0 !important}@media screen and (max-width:768px){.cta-wrap .cta_button{font-size:14px}.navbar .cta-wrap .cta_button{padding:8px 16px !important}.navbar .cta-wrap .cta_button strong{font-size:12px !important;line-height:15px !important}}.navbar{position:fixed;left:0;right:0;top:0;width:100%;min-height:80px;padding:18px 0;z-index:10}.navbar .container{display:flex;flex-direction:row;align-items:center;justify-content:space-between}.navbar.is-scrolled{background:#10275b}.navbar__logo{display:block}.navbar__logo .hs_cos_wrapper_type_cta:last-of-type{display:none}.navbar.is-scrolled .navbar__logo .hs_cos_wrapper_type_cta:last-of-type{display:block}.navbar.is-scrolled .navbar__logo .hs_cos_wrapper_type_cta:first-of-type{display:none}.navbar__logo img{width:100%;max-width:127px;height:auto}@media only screen and (max-width:992px){.navbar .container{text-align:center}}.hero{position:relative;padding-top:14rem;z-index:4;overflow:hidden}.hero:before{display:block;content:'';position:absolute;width:2257px;height:916px;left:50%;top:0;-webkit-transform:translate(-525px,-390px);-ms-transform:translate(-525px,-390px);transform:translate(-525px,-390px);background:url(https://f.hubspotusercontent20.net/hubfs/2950575/img-wave-header-3-1.svg) no-repeat;z-index:-11}@media only screen and (max-width:992px){.hero{padding-top:10rem}.hero:before{display:none;content:inherit}}.hero__inner{display:-webkit-box;display:-ms-flexbox;display:flex;flex-direction:row;align-items:center}@media only screen and (max-width:992px){.hero__inner{-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column}}.hero__content{-webkit-box-flex:1;-ms-flex:1;flex:1}.hero__content img{display:block;width:56px;height:56px;margin:12px 0}.hero__content h1{color:#10275b;font-size:4rem;line-height:5rem;margin:0 0 2rem;width:100%;display:block;max-width:42rem}@media only screen and (max-width:992px){.hero__content h1{margin:0 auto;font-size:3.6rem}}.hero__content .content-wrap{font-size:2rem;padding:1.5rem 0;width:100%;max-width:40rem}@media only screen and (max-width:992px){.hero__content .content-wrap{margin:0 auto}}.hero__inner .cta-wrap{margin-top:20px}@media only screen and (max-width:992px){.hero__content{text-align:center}.hero__content img{margin:0 auto 15px}.hero__inner .cta-wrap{margin:10px 0 20px}}.hero__img{-webkit-box-flex:1;-ms-flex:1;flex:1}.hero__img img{display:block;max-width:946px;width:100%}@media only screen and (max-width:992px){.hero__img img{max-width:400px;margin:0 auto}}.faq{padding:6rem 0 .5rem}@media only screen and (min-width:993px){.faq{padding:12rem 0 0}}.faq h2{display:block;margin:0 0 4rem;font-size:3.8rem}@media only screen and (max-width:992px){.faq h2{font-size:2.8rem}}.faq__inner ul{margin:3rem 0}.faq__inner ul li{padding:1rem 0}.faq__item{position:relative;cursor:pointer;-webkit-appearance:none;-moz-appearance:none;appearance:none;background:0;font-family:'LL Circular Pro',sans-serif;border:0;outline:0;font-size:2rem;font-weight:700;color:#10275b;padding:0 0 0 25px;line-height:1;text-align:left}@media only screen and (max-width:992px){.faq__item{font-size:2.2rem}}.faq__item::before{content:"";width:10px;height:2px;background-color:#fa5767;position:absolute;left:0;top:9px}.faq__item::after{content:"";width:10px;height:2px;background-color:#fa5767;position:absolute;left:0;top:9px;-webkit-transform:rotate(90deg);-ms-transform:rotate(90deg);transform:rotate(90deg);-webkit-transition:-webkit-transform .3s ease-in-out;transition:-webkit-transform .3s ease-in-out;-o-transition:transform .3s ease-in-out;transition:transform .3s ease-in-out;transition:transform .3s ease-in-out,-webkit-transform .3s ease-in-out}.faq__item.is-open::after{-webkit-transform:rotate(0);-ms-transform:rotate(0);transform:rotate(0)}.faq__content{display:none}.faq__content .content-wrap{font-size:2rem;font-weight:400;line-height:1.5;padding:1.5rem 0}.faq__content a{text-decoration:none;color:#fa5767}@media only screen and (min-width:993px){.testimonials{padding:6rem 0}}.testimonials__slider{margin:40px 0}.testimonials__slider::before{content:"";display:block;width:40px;height:40px;margin:10px auto;background-image:url(https://f.hubspotusercontent20.net/hubfs/2950575/quote-4.png);background-size:contain;background-repeat:no-repeat;background-position:center}.testimonials__slider .quote{padding:10px;text-align:center}.testimonials__slider .quote__text{font-size:3.8rem;font-weight:700;width:100%;max-width:990px;margin:0 auto}@media only screen and (max-width:992px){.testimonials__slider .quote__text{font-size:2rem}}.testimonials__slider .quote__credit{font-size:1.5rem;display:-webkit-inline-box;display:-ms-inline-flexbox;display:inline-flex;margin:30px 0 0;font-weight:700}.testimonials__slider .quote__credit .company{display:flex;flex-direction:row;align-items:center}.testimonials__slider .quote__credit .company::before{content:"|";margin:0 2rem}.testimonials .slick-slide:focus{outline:0}.testimonials .slick-dots{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.testimonials .slick-dots li button{cursor:pointer;-webkit-appearance:none;-moz-appearance:none;appearance:none;background:0;border:0;outline:0;font-size:0;width:10px;height:10px;border-radius:50%;margin:0 5px;background-color:#b7bece}.testimonials .slick-dots li.slick-active button{background-color:#10275b}.cta{padding:9rem 0}@media only screen and (max-width:992px){.cta{padding:2rem 0}}.cta__inner{display:-webkit-box;display:-ms-flexbox;display:flex}@media only screen and (max-width:992px){.cta__inner{-webkit-box-orient:vertical;-webkit-box-direction:reverse;-ms-flex-direction:column-reverse;flex-direction:column-reverse}}.cta__img{-webkit-box-flex:0;-ms-flex:0 0 45%;flex:0 0 45%}.cta__img img{display:block;width:100%;max-width:612px}@media only screen and (max-width:992px){.cta__img img{margin:0 auto}}@media only screen and (max-width:992px){.cta__content{padding:0 0 2rem}}.cta__content h3{font-size:4rem}@media only screen and (max-width:992px){.cta__content h3{font-size:3rem}}.cta__content .cta-wrap{margin:3rem 0 0}@media only screen and (max-width:992px){.cta__content{text-align:center}.cta__content .cta-wrap{margin:2rem auto}}@media only screen and (min-width:993px){.cta{background-image:url(https://f.hubspotusercontent20.net/hubfs/2950575/shape-2.svg);background-size:780px;background-position:left;background-repeat:no-repeat}}.content-img .inner{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-direction:row;flex-direction:row;-ms-flex-wrap:wrap;flex-wrap:wrap}@media only screen and (max-width:992px){.content-img .inner{-webkit-box-orient:vertical;-webkit-box-direction:reverse;-ms-flex-direction:column-reverse;flex-direction:column-reverse;text-align:center}}.content-img--reversed .inner{-webkit-box-orient:horizontal;-webkit-box-direction:reverse;-ms-flex-direction:row-reverse;flex-direction:row-reverse}@media only screen and (max-width:992px){.content-img--reversed .inner{-webkit-box-orient:vertical;-webkit-box-direction:reverse;-ms-flex-direction:column-reverse;flex-direction:column-reverse;text-align:center}}.content-img__content{-webkit-box-flex:1;-ms-flex:1;flex:1}.content-img__content .content-wrap{width:100%;max-width:45rem}.content-img__img{-webkit-box-flex:1;-ms-flex:1;flex:1}.content-img__img img{display:block;width:100%;max-width:575px;margin:0 auto}@media only screen and (max-width:992px){.content-img__img img{margin:1rem auto 2.5rem}}.content-img--1{padding:11rem 0}@media only screen and (min-width:993px){.content-img--1{background-image:url(https://f.hubspotusercontent20.net/hubfs/2950575/shape-1.svg);background-size:600px;background-position:center right -200px;background-repeat:no-repeat}}@media only screen and (max-width:992px){.content-img--1{padding:6rem 0 0}}.content-img--2{padding:8rem 0}@media only screen and (min-width:993px){.content-img--2{background-image:url(https://f.hubspotusercontent20.net/hubfs/2950575/shape-2.svg);background-size:820px;background-position:left;background-repeat:no-repeat}}@media only screen and (max-width:992px){.content-img--2{padding:6rem 0}}.content-img--4{padding:8rem 6rem}@media only screen and (max-width:992px){.content-img--4{padding:8rem 1rem 0}}.content-img--5{padding:4rem 2rem}@media only screen and (max-width:992px){.content-img--5{padding:8rem 1rem}}.content-block{padding:4rem 0}@media only screen and (max-width:992px){.content-block{padding:4rem 0 10rem}}.content-block .inner{position:relative}.content-block__block{background-color:#fff;width:100%;min-height:430px;-webkit-box-shadow:2px 7px 20px rgba(0,0,0,0.25);box-shadow:2px 7px 20px rgba(0,0,0,0.25);text-align:center;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-ms-flex-align:center;align-items:center;padding:20px}.content-block img{width:100%;max-width:200px !important;position:absolute;right:0;bottom:0;-webkit-transform:translateY(65px);-ms-transform:translateY(65px);transform:translateY(65px)}@media only screen and (max-width:992px){.content-block img{display:none}}.content-block .content-wrap{width:100%;max-width:65rem}.content-block--reversed img{right:initial;left:0}.footer{background-color:#10275b}.footer__main{display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ap;padding:7rem 0 1rem}.footer__item{-webkit-box-flex:1;-ms-flex:1;flex:1}@media screen and (max-width:992px){.footer__item{-webkit-box-flex:1;-ms-flex:1 1 35%;flex:1 1 35%;padding:2rem}}.footer__item h5{font-size:1.8rem;font-weight:700;color:#fa5767;margin:0 0 2rem}.footer__item ul li{margin:0 0 7px;max-width:272px}.footer__item ul li a{display:block;font-size:16px;font-weight:300;color:#fff;text-decoration:none;-webkit-transition:color .3s ease;-o-transition:color .3s ease;transition:color .3s ease}.footer__item ul li a:hover{color:#3b9dff}.footer__item--social{margin:30px 0 0;display:-webkit-box;display:-ms-flexbox;display:flex}.footer__item--social li{display:inline-block;margin:0 15px 0 0 !important}.footer__item--social li a{display:inline-block;width:25px;height:25px;border-radius:50%;padding:5px;background-color:#3b9dff;-webkit-transition:background-color .3s ease !important;-o-transition:background-color .3s ease !important;transition:background-color .3s ease !important}.footer__item--social li a:hover{background-color:#fa5767}.footer__item--social li img{display:block;width:100%;height:100%;-o-object-fit:contain;object-fit:contain}.footer__bottom{text-align:center}.footer__bottom p{color:#fff;font-size:12px}